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ques aimed at correcting and reinforcing the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, piering, or mudjacking, which are designed to address issues related to uneven settling, shifting, or sinking of the foundation. The process often involves installing support systems beneath the foundation to lift and stabilize it, helping to restore proper alignment and prevent further movement. By implementing these solutions, property owners can improve the stability of their structures and protect against potential damage caused by foundation failure.
These services are primarily sought to resolve common foundation problems such as c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, and doors or windows that no longer open or close properly. Foundation instability can lead to significant structural issues if left unaddressed, including further cracking, interior damage, or even safety hazards. Foundation stabilizing solutions are designed to mitigate these risks by providing a long-term reinforcement that prevents further shifting or settling. This proactive approach can help preserve the value and safety of the property while reducing the likelihood of costly repairs in the future.
Properties that typically require foundation stabilizing services include residential homes, especially those built on expansive or unstable soil, as well as commercial buildings experiencing signs of foundation movement. Older structures are often more vulnerable to foundation issues due to the natural aging of materials and shifting ground conditions over time. Additionally, properties located in areas prone to soil movement, such as regions with significant clay content or high moisture levels, are more likely to benefit from foundation stabilization. Foundation Stabilizing Costs - Typical expenses for foundation stabilization services range from $3,000 to $15,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, a small repair in South Saint Paul might cost around $3,500, while larger projects could reach $12,000 or more.
Material and Equipment Fees - The cost of materials and specialized equipment can vary widely, often representing 20-30% of the total project cost. Basic stabilization methods may cost around $1,000, whereas advanced systems could add several thousand dollars to the overall budget.
Labor and Service Charges - Labor costs for foundation stabilization services typically range from $50 to $150 per hour. The total labor expense depends on project size, with a standard job in the South Saint Paul area averaging between $2,000 and $8,000.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s such as permits, inspections, or site preparation may add $500 to $2,500 to the overall cost. These expenses vary based on local regulations and the specific requirements of each stabilization project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Piering and underpinning are common methods used to stabilize foundations by installing supports beneath the structure, often needed in cases of uneven settling or damage.
Mudjacking and slab jacking services are utilized to lift and level sunken concrete slabs, helping to restore stability to foundation-supported surfaces.
Soil stabilization services focus on improving the ground conditions around foundations to prevent future shifting and ensure long-term stability.
Crack injection and sealing are techniques performed by local specialists to fill and seal foundation cracks, reducing water infiltration and further deterioration.
